Device Setup / ...Concentration
The menu is only available if the DensiMass function is activated
Medium Selection of measuring medium for concentration measurement using the DensiMass function.
• Variable Matrix
• Sodium Hydroxide
• Alcohol Water
• Wheat Starch
• Corn Starch
• Sugar in H2O
• °API Gravity
Sub Matrix Selection Selection of sub-matrix for concentration measurement.
Only available if the matrix selected from Medium has two sub-matrices.
Reference Temp. Sets the reference temperature for calculating process variables Vol.Flow@Tref and Density@Tref [unit].

Device Setup / Variable Matrix / ...Configuration
Number Matrices Selection of number (1/2) of the matrices.
Number Temp. Entry of the number of temperature values.
Number Conc. Entry of the number of concentration values.
Enter Conc. in % Selection of whether the concentration value must be entered in %.
• Yes: Entry of the concentration values in %
• No: Entry of the concentration values in a selected unit.
NOTICE
A net flow cannot be calculated if the concentration has only been entered in a unit. To enable the net flow to be calculated,
the concentration must also be entered in %.
Qm / Qv Conc. Switch Selection of whether the entered concentration values are volume or mass concentration values. The values are used to
calculate the mass flow or volume flow rate.
• Mass Concentration
• Volume Concentration
Reset Matrix All entered matrix values are reset to ‘0’.
